System Glitch Causes Major Mishap with Disney Dining Reservations

On Tuesday, November 3rd, Disney’s dining reservation and experience booking system experienced an unanticipated technical issue for a brief period of time. Apparently, while the IT department worked to resolve the problem, the system inadvertently displayed availability at locations that actually were not available and were fully booked already. Disney Imagineering Shares Sneak Peek of Guardians of the Galaxy Ride Vehicles

On his Instagram account, Disney Imagineer Zach Riddley has shared a sneak peek at the ride vehicles of the upcoming Guardians of the Galaxy: Cosmic Rewind attractions that is being built in Future World at EPCOT. Disney Provides Update On Minnie Van Service from MCO

As we’ve previously reported, Minnie Van service is temporarily unavailable at Walt Disney World Resort. Walt Disney World has just officially announced that Minnie Van service to and from Orlando International Airport (MCO) will not be available for bookings until further notice, including as either a package add-on or standalone option. EPCOT Restaurant No Longer Accepting Reservations After Dec. 10

According to Walt Disney World’s website, reservations at EPCOT‘s Spice Road Table will not be taken past December 10th, 2020. Spice Road Table, located beside World Showcase Lagoon in the Morocco pavilion, features a Mediterranean-inspired menu highlighting tapas and sharable plates.
